WebDeadweight Pressure Testers. Deadweight Pressure Testers obtain pressure by the combination of a mass, typically weights, which are floated on a cylinder and piston combination with a defined area. The deadweight tester’s basic equation is: P = F/A. Where: P = the pressure being derived. F = the force applied by the weights.
